High risk OB doctor: You need to be seen by a high risk OB doctor. They are called Maternal fetal Medicine doctors. They will be able to evaluate you and recommend further treatment options. Remember there are different types of cerclages. There is a technique that places the cerclage inside your abdomen low around your cervix.
